One-Way Non-Disclosure Agreement — Long Form (Counterparty Side)
A comprehensive One-Way Non-Disclosure Agreement drafted from the counterparty position, covering the agreement that protects information flowing in one direction, with the recipient carrying all the obligations.
Every allocation of risk is made deliberately in your favor, with the reasoning noted for the negotiation. The complete protective provision set for a transaction where the downside justifies negotiating every term.

The fee covers the finished document, filing-ready or send-ready as applicable, the supporting exhibits or attachments described in the scope, and a short cover memorandum explaining the choices made. It is fixed at this scope: two parties. 2 rounds of revisions are included. If your matter falls outside that scope we tell you before starting and quote the difference — we do not bill past a flat fee without agreeing it first.
3 to 5 business days from a complete set of instructions, plus time for the 2 rounds of revisions included in the fee. If you are working to a court deadline or a closing date, tell us when you order and we will confirm in writing whether we can meet it before you commit.
$1,475 is $325/hour × 4.5 hours — the time this deliverable takes in an ordinary confidentiality matter, at the firm's standard rate. Because it is a flat fee, the risk of the work running long sits with the firm: you pay $1,475 whether it takes us the estimate or twice it.
Third-party costs are never inside a flat fee and are passed through at cost, never marked up: court and agency filing fees, court reporter and transcript charges, expert witness fees, search vendor and e-discovery hosting charges, process server fees, and travel.
The business terms you have agreed so far, the counterparty and which side of the deal you are on, any existing draft, term sheet, or prior agreement, and your risk tolerance on the provisions that matter most to you. Send what you have — if something is missing we will tell you what else we need before the turnaround clock starts.
